WebAs per the latest report, there are approximately 12.9 million cattle, with 4.2 million dairy cows and 0.7 million suckler cows in Germany. The four dominating cow breeds here are German Holsteins and Red Holsteins, the German Fleckvieh, and the German Braunvieh, contributing almost 80% of all the breeds.
